### What happened?

In Hop 2.19 the **REST Connection** metadata now includes settings for using a proxy to connect.

When using a "proxied" connection in a **REST Client**, the proxy settings in it are now disabled. If specified in a previous version of Hop, they are also ignored and need to be specified/moved in the selected connection.
